    2005 Tr196 Re-power or Move On

    The Optimax 150 on my 196 lost #6 so I sit trying to decide if I should re-power with a new x brand 200HP 4stroke or move on from this hull. I enjoy the hull as a fishing platform but I've found it lacking with the 150hp. I know it's a personal decision whether or not to drop 17k on new motor on 16 model year old hull as I know I would never get the $ back out if I were to try to sell it. Has any had a similar situation and, if so, did you go back with a new Mercury or change brands? I've gotten quotes on Mercury (17k) and I'm working on a quote for a Suzuki 200SS. The boat is in good condition and similar new is a tad more than 17k. Any advice our thoughts are appreciated.

    I personally think putting a new motor with warranty on a older in good shape hull is the way to go. I restored a 97 tr21 w/ a 2019 225 pro xs new carpet, a ultrex and have now approximately 30k in the boat. I do not regret doing it at all. And she is a pretty quick old boat. My vote is if the hull is in good shape. Repower is the way to go.

    I just went through this with my 2004 Stratos. I purchased a new leftover Optimax 200 ProXS and had it installed. I replaced the carpet and added a recessed pedal tray for the TM. I also had my bucket seats reupholstered and the boat finish sanded and polished. My boat looks like new and runs like new. I just could not bring myself to spend $50K on a new boat of equal size.
